Official Journal of the European Union

C 304/15

(Joined Cases T-289/11, T-290/11 and T-521/11) (<span class="super">1</span>)

(Competition - Administrative procedure - Decision ordering an inspection - Inspection powers of the Commission - Rights of the defence - Proportionality - Duty to state reasons)

2013/C 304/25

Language of the case: German

Parties

Applicants: Deutsche Bahn AG (Berlin, Germany); DB Mobility Logistics AG (Berlin); DB Energie GmbH (Frankfurt-am-Main, Germany); DB Netz AG (Frankfurt-am-Main); DB Schenker Rail GmbH (Mainz, Germany); DB Schenker Rail Deutschland AG (Mainz); Deutsche Umschlaggesellschaft Schiene-Straße mbH (DUSS) (Bodenheim, Germany) (represented by: W. Deselaers, O. Mross and J. Brückner, lawyers)

Defendant: European Commission (represented by: L. Malferrari, N. von Lingen and R. Sauer, acting as Agents)

Interveners in support of the form of order sought by the defendant: Kingdom of Spain (represented initially, in Cases T-289/11 and T-290/11, by: M. Muñoz Pérez, then, in Cases T-289/11, T-290/11 and T-521/11, by: S. Centeno Huerta, abogados del Estado); Council of the European Union (represented by: M. Simm and F. Florindo Gijón, acting as Agents); and EFTA Surveillance Authority (represented by: X.A. Lewis, M. Schneider and M. Moustakali, acting as Agents)

Re:

Annulment of Commission Decisions C(2011)1774 of 14 March 2011, C(2011) 2365 of 30 March 2011 and C(2011) 5230 of 14 July 2011 ordering Deutsche Bahn AG and all its subsidiaries, to submit to inspections under Article 20(4) of Council Regulation (EC) No 1/2003, (Cases COMP/39.678 and COMP/39.731).

Operative part of the judgment

The Court:

1.Dismisses the actions;

2.Orders Deutsche Bahn AG, DB Mobility Logistics AG, DB Energie GmbH, DB Netz AG, DB Schenker Rail GmbH, DB Schenker Rail Deutschland AG and Deutsche Umschlaggesellschaft Schiene-Straße mbH (DUSS) to pay the costs incurred by the European Commission and to bear their own costs;

3.Orders the Council of the European Union, the EFTA Surveillance Authority and the Kingdom of Spain to bear their own costs.
